The Iran Conflict – Executive Briefing – March 2026
The UAE MoD has reported 1,006 threats: 186 ballistic missiles, 812 drones/UAVs, and 8 cruise missiles. Reported interceptions were 172/186 (~92%) ballistic and 755/812 (~93%) drones, including a “new wave” of 123 drones intercepted in 24 hours on Mar 3.
U.S. officials have indicated that military operations could last four to five weeks, although they have also stated that some operational objectives may be achieved earlier than expected.
Energy Crisis: Impact of Iran Conflict on Global Fuel Prices

Brent Crude Oil: Prices were relatively stable around $70–$72 per barrel in late February. Following the strikes and the subsequent maritime blockade, Brent surged by over $14 a barrel, trading at approximately $83 on 4 March
